are 380s enough?

Ive searched all over the forum to no avail.

Currently i have an 04 mcs with a cai, 15% pulley and exhaust.

id like to install an RMW header, RMW cam and injectors as well as get the car tuned. Id gladly go with 450 injectors but id like to install the injectors and cam before heading off to get the car tuned leaving me with the question, are 380s enough?

Ive seen plenty of people run 380s with the cam and header but I just want to make sure im not going to be limiting the ability to tune the car aka...run out of fuel to gain max performance? Im not worried about not being able to increase the rev limiter cuz i know the 380s limit that atleast a little bit.

Since you sre paying $$ to get the car tuned, ask the tuner...
My gut instinct is you car can make more than the 210 hp that the 380's are good (with very safe afr) for with your list of parts....

It will run. I ran the same mods minus the header for about 6 months before I got the tune done. Though your injectors will be running at about 90-95% duty cycle so just go easy and you will be fine. The only reason I say to wait is if you go with 450cc injectors the car will run pig rich and destroy your cat. If you do decide to install the 380s then yeah, by all means install the same time as the cam.

Yes, you won't really have to baby it, just drive normally, don't WOT the car and don't run for any length of time at high rpm and you won't push the injectors near their limit, highway cruising they're probably only at 55 to 60% anyway.
